Skip to main content
Search
Search This Blog
The Train Wreck Love Life
Pages
Home
More…
Share
Get link
Facebook
X
Pinterest
Email
Other Apps
Labels
fascism
musicals
politics
protests
revolution
February 28, 2025
do you hear the people sing?
Happy Buy Nothing from Billionaires Day.
Comments
Popular Posts
January 02, 2009
I'm a lost cause, not a hero
December 23, 2024
now I know you need the dark just as much as the sun (part two)
Comments